Our Energy Audit Process

1

Equipment Inventory & Age Assessment

We document all HVAC units (make, model, capacity, installation date), identify refrigerant types (R22 phase-out urgency), and flag units older than 10 years for priority replacement consideration.

Duration: 2-4 hours on-site for typical office building

2

Electricity Consumption Analysis

Using your utility bills and amp draw measurements, we calculate current HVAC electricity costs per unit. We compare this to optimal consumption rates for inverter-driven equivalents to quantify wasted kWh.

Data required: 12 months of electricity bills (or access to utility account)

3

Performance Testing & Efficiency Rating

Thermal imaging to detect coil blockages, refrigerant pressure checks to identify leaks, temperature differential measurement (supply vs return air), and electrical performance testing including capacitor degradation.

Findings: Each unit receives an efficiency score (0-100%) and maintenance urgency rating

Real Client Example: Office Building ROI

Before Audit (Baseline)

HVAC Units:12 units (avg 8 years old)
Technology:Non-inverter split systems
Annual HVAC electricity:N$ 180,000
Maintenance failures:6 emergency repairs/year

After Inverter Upgrade

HVAC Units:12 inverter-driven units
Technology:Daikin inverter + Mitsubishi Electric
Annual HVAC electricity:N$ 108,000
Maintenance failures:1 emergency repair/year (est.)

Annual Savings

N$ 72,000

(40% reduction)

Total Investment

N$ 216,000

(12 units @ avg N$18k/unit)

Payback Period

3.0 years

(Electricity savings only)

Additional benefits not quantified: Reduced emergency repair costs, extended equipment lifespan (15+ years vs 8-10 years), improved tenant comfort, and lower carbon footprint.

Most commercial facilities with HVAC units older than 8 years see electricity reductions of 30–50% after switching to modern inverter-driven systems. The exact saving depends on how old your current units are, how many hours per day they run, and the local electricity tariff. Our written report will give you a facility-specific projection using your actual consumption data, not generic estimates.
For commercial facilities in Namibia, payback periods typically run 2–4 years based on electricity savings alone, using NamPower commercial tariffs (approximately N$2.50/kWh). A facility spending N$180,000/year on HVAC electricity can reduce that to around N$108,000 with inverter systems—saving N$72,000/year. On a N$216,000 replacement investment that is a 3-year payback. Reduced maintenance and emergency repair costs shorten the payback further.
